From scenarios to networks [electronic resource] :performing the intercultural in colonial Mexico / Leo Cabranes-Grant.

By: Cabranes-Grant, Leo, 1960- [author.].
Contributor(s): Project Muse.
Material type: materialTypeLabelBookSeries: Performance works: ; UPCC book collections on Project MUSE: Publisher: Evanston, Illinois : Northwestern University Press, 2016. 2015)Description: 1 online resource (pages cm).Content type: text Media type: computer Carrier type: online resourceISBN: 9780810133938; 0810133938.Subject(s): Intercultural communication -- Mexico -- History | Performing arts -- Anthropological aspects -- Mexico | Performing arts -- Social aspects -- Mexico -- History | Mexico -- Social life and customs | Mexico -- History -- Spanish colony, 1540-1810Genre/Form: Electronic books. DDC classification: 791.097209032 Online resources: Full text available:
Contents:
Introduction. Passing through the network : toward a new historiography of the intercultural past -- Networking the scenario : the Avila-Cortes insurrection -- Reassembling the bones : the festival of the relics -- Indian weddings and translocalized drums : mobilizing the intercultural in the Cantares Mexicanos -- Geochronic scripts : Sor Juana Ines de la Cruz and the divine Narcissus -- (Not a) conclusion.
